14. It was narrated to me by Muhammad b. al-Hassan who said it was narrated to me by Muhammad b. al-Hassan al-Saffar from Ahmad from al-Hussain b. Ali b. Fadhal from ’Amru b. Sa’eed al-Madaini from Musdaq b. Sadaqah from Ammar b. Musa from Abi Abdillah who said who said:
Imam Ja’far Sadiq was asked about the ruling against the person who uses an intoxicant. Imam replied, “His prayers will not be accepted for next forty days and he cannot repent during these forty days. If he dies during these days, he will go to Hell.”
